Velvet Butter Cookies (Printable Version)

# What You’ll Need:

01 - A box of Red Velvet cake mix.
02 - One egg, large.
03 - Half a cup of white chocolate chips.
04 - Half a cup of butter, take it out early so it's soft.
05 - Powdered sugar, half a cup plus some extra if you wanna sprinkle on top.
06 - Eight ounces softened cream cheese.
07 - A teaspoon of vanilla flavor.

# Extra Notes:

01 - Whip up soft cookies with just a cake mix and a few extras.
02 - If you like them extra gooey inside, cut the oven time a bit.
03 - A scoop makes it way easier to get same-size cookies.
04 - Switch up the cake mix for other flavors whenever you feel like it.
